About Me
As Program Director of the General Practice Residency at MetroHealth Medical Center and a faculty member at Case Western Reserve University, I’ve dedicated my career to advancing dental education and delivering exceptional patient care. With over 20 years of clinical and academic experience, I’ve had the privilege of training future dentists while continuing to care for patients in a hospital-based setting.
My background includes dual MBAs in Healthcare Administration and Data Analytics, which help me approach dentistry with a broader understanding of systems, efficiency, and innovation. I’m also proud to be a Fellow of the Academy of General Dentistry—a recognition of my commitment to lifelong learning and excellence in comprehensive dental care.
My clinical expertise includes advanced implant and restorative techniques, as well as full-spectrum general dentistry. I’m passionate about helping patients achieve healthy, confident smiles through personalized treatment plans that combine the latest technology with a compassionate touch.
In addition to patient care, I’m deeply involved in curriculum development and mentoring. I believe that strong education leads to better outcomes—not just for students, but for the communities we serve.
Whether I’m working with residents or treating patients directly, my goal is always the same: to provide thoughtful, high-quality care that makes a lasting difference.
